iphoto does not show Olympus C-740 Ultra Zoom camera

I can't import photos to iPhoto 11 because it does not recognize Olympus C-740 Ultra Zoom camera. I am using Lion 10.7.5.

iPhoto doesn't recognise any camera, what it sees is the Card.


If that's not showing up it often means directory damage on the card, for which the solution is to reformat the card with the camera.


However, be aware that this will erase the card. Folks can often manage to get the photos by using another Mac or Windows computer first.

And read your camera manual - the camera needs to be set to mass storage mode for most cameras - if you have it set to the wrong mode the Mac will not see it


Other possible causes could be a bad USB cable or an issue with the camera - often a USB (or iMac built in) card reader is a better solution that connecting the camera


a best practice to is to never have any computer program (including iPhoto) delete the photos from the card but to import the photos and keep them and then after at least one successful backup cycle has completed and then reformat the card -- I use three very large (32 GB) cards in rotation so I do not reformat for typically a year or more giving me one more long term backup of my photos
